MKZ AWD V6-3.5L VIN T (2007)
Catalytic Converter: Service and Repair
Catalytic Converter - LH Manifold
Catalytic Converter - 3.5L LH
Removal and Installation
1. NOTE: Always install new fasteners and gaskets. Clean flange faces prior to new gasket installation to make sure of proper sealing.
With the vehicle in NEUTRAL, position it on a hoist.
2. Disconnect the catalyst monitor sensor (CMS) electrical connector.
3. Remove the exhaust Y-pipe.
4. Remove the 2 catalytic converter support bracket-to-transmission bolts.
^
To install, tighten to 48 Nm (35 ft. lbs.).
5. Remove the 4 nuts and the LH catalytic converter.
^
Discard the 4 LH catalytic converter nuts and gasket.
^
To install, tighten to 40 Nm (30 ft. lbs.).
6. Remove and discard the 4 LH catalytic converter-to-exhaust manifold studs.
^
To install, tighten to 25 Nm (18 ft. lbs.).
7.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
^
Install a new gasket and nuts.
